The brain compares effortlessly when things sit next to each other — which is why before/after pairs, versus comparisons and step sequences are the most shared image format on the web. This tool builds them without any editor: select the images, pick the direction, download.
Use cases: progress photos, renovation before/after, product comparison, screenshot stitching, proof screenshots and portfolio pairs.

Select both images (the file picker allows multiple), keep 'Horizontal' direction and download. The result is one image with both photos left-to-right, in selection order.
Select the 'before' photo first and the 'after' second, choose horizontal mode with a small gap, and download. For a more polished card, add BEFORE/AFTER labels to each image first with our Add Text to Image tool.
By default they align at the top on a shared canvas. Enable 'match height' to scale every image to the first one's height — the standard look for comparison strips.
Yes — switch direction to 'Vertical' and the images flow top to bottom. Useful for receipts, chat exports and step-by-step sequences.
Up to six per merge. For bigger collages, merge in batches (combine results) — or keep it simple: beyond six, a collage grid communicates better than a strip.
No — images are drawn at their original resolution (unless height-matching scales one down). Export as PNG for zero loss.
